Minimum Qualifications
High school diploma or GED; two years of automotive parts experience in ordering, stocking, and issuing parts, equipment, and supplies; or an equivalent combination of training and experience. Working knowledge of principles and practices of inventory management. Ability to read and interpret parts and supply catalogs, including on-line versions; to perform basic mathematical calculations; to perform physically demanding work including, but not limited to walking up and down stairs, heavy lifting, standing for prolonged periods, squatting, stooping , bending, twisting, stretching, crawling, reaching overhead, and working in awkward positions without choice or variety; to operate a personal computer and related software and other standard office equipment; to communicate effectively orally and in writing; to develop and maintain effective working relationships with internal and external customers.
Current valid driver's license and good driving record required. Based on the Virginia DMV point system, records must not reflect a total of six or more demerit points within the twenty-four months preceding the anticipated hire date, or one major violation of six demerit points within the preceding thirty-six months. Out-of-state driving records must be obtained by the applicant and presented at time of interview. Records must reflect at least three years of history and be dated within thirty days of the interview date.
Pre-employment drug testing, FBI criminal background check and education/degree verification required.
Duties
Under general supervision of Parts Supervisor, performs work of routine difficulty in procurement and issuance of vehicle parts (light duty, heavy duty, and bus), equipment and supplies. Orders, receives, issues and stock/stores parts, equipment, supplies and materials. Inspects parts, supplies and equipment for conformity with specifications, contacts vendors regarding discrepancies. Research and orders specialized, or non-stock items as needed. Assists in conducting inventories. Maintains contact with vendors regarding availability of parts, status of orders, and alternative sources of supply. Ensures parts are reconciled to work orders for billing. Performs computer data entry of inventory received, stock issues, and parts transactions. Perform other work as required.
This position is a part of an approved Career Development Plan (CDP) and offers career progression opportunities and salary incentives, as funding permits, based on performance, qualifications, and experience.
